Sébastien Ogier discovered the 24 Hours of Le Mans with the Richard Mille Racing Team © Germain Hazard / DPPI

Philippe Sinault proudly announced that the Richard Mille Racing Team made up of Charles Milesi, Lilou Wadoux and Sébastien Ogier had taken on a new dimension during this week at Le Mans. A few minutes from returning to his stand to celebrate a fine 9th place in category, the eight-time World Rally Champion looked back on his race and his future.
